What is Baby White Noise?

Baby white noise is a type of sound that mimics the constant, soothing sounds that babies hear in the womb. These sounds include the mother’s heartbeat, the whooshing of blood through the placenta, and the muffled noises of the outside world.

How Does Baby White Noise Work?

White noise works by masking other distracting sounds that can trigger a baby’s startle reflex or keep them awake. It creates a calming and womb-like environment that helps babies relax and fall asleep.

Choosing the Right Baby White Noise

When choosing baby white noise, consider the following factors:

  • Volume: The volume should be loud enough to mask distracting sounds but not so loud as to damage the baby’s hearing.
  • Frequency: Different frequencies of white noise can have different effects. Some babies prefer lower frequencies, while others prefer higher frequencies.
  • Type: Natural, mechanical, or electronic white noise can all be effective. Choose the type that best suits your baby’s preferences.

How to Use Baby White Noise

To use baby white noise effectively:

  • Start Early: Introduce white noise as soon as possible after birth.
  • Use Regularly: Use white noise consistently during naps and bedtime.
  • Place Near Baby: Position the white noise source close to the baby’s crib or bassinet.
  • Monitor Volume: Ensure the volume is appropriate and does not exceed 50 decibels.
  • Avoid Overuse: Limit white noise use to sleep times and avoid using it for extended periods during the day.

Safety Considerations

While baby white noise is generally safe, there are some safety considerations to keep in mind:

  • Hearing Damage: Prolonged exposure to loud white noise can damage a baby’s hearing.
  • Sleep Dependence: Overuse of white noise can make babies dependent on it for sleep.
  • Other Health Issues: In rare cases, white noise may trigger respiratory problems or other health issues.
